Mechanical Failure

Trains are huge machines however, even a minor mechanical failure can be devastating in the event that it occurs while the train is in motion. With all the moving parts and complex systems that are found in trains, they need constant inspection and maintenance to prevent any equipment malfunction or defect from arising. This is why it's important that train companies, their employees, and commuter rail lines fulfill their obligation to perform regular checks to ensure safety of their passengers.

Human error and negligence are the main reason for train accidents. For instance engineers or conductors may neglect to follow the railroad's guidelines for train speed limits signals, braking, and other restrictions. This can cause trains to go too fast around corners, or it may fail to brake in time to avoid obstacles on the tracks.

The 140,000 miles of railway tracks that run across the country can be dangerous if they aren't properly maintained or safe for travel. Accidents and derailments could result from cracks or broken rails, tracks that aren't aligned properly, or objects that are left on the tracks.

Defective train equipment is a frequent reason for accidents, and includes defective wheels, locomotive bearings, and car bearings that can lead to derailment. This could be due inadequate lubrication or insufficient maintenance. Manufacturing flaws could also impact the performance and safety of the train.

Obstacles on tracks can cause accidents, like abandoned vehicles, tools or debris. This is the leading cause of accidents involving tracks and is extremely hazardous for both drivers and passengers. Incorrect switch alignment for instance, could cause trains to either be in collision or not be able to move from one set of tracks to another when they're supposed to do so.

Poorly maintained tracks

Rail companies are responsible for the maintenance of the huge machines that travel for hundreds of miles on tracks. If a railroad doesn't properly maintain its tracks the people who use it are at risk of severe injury.

Derailments are caused by a number of causes, and they could result in serious injuries and property damage. In many cases, it is simply human error that causes a train to shift off the rails. This could be due to an oversight by the engineer when driving the train too fast or not following signals from the railway. This could also be caused by faulty track switches, or malfunctioning equipment. In certain instances environmental conditions can cause tracks to fail, like extreme weather conditions or land slides.

Sometimes, the only explanation for an accident involving a train is the negligence of the railroad company. Tracks must be inspected regularly, and if they are discovered to be damaged or deteriorating the railroad company should fix them immediately. It is also important to ensure that all trains are secured at all times. Unattended train cars can be pulled off the tracks or derailed by a train that is speeding.

It is also crucial to follow the correct safety procedures at all train crossings. These include clearly visible warning signs and reflective safety tape. Other equipment includes mounted safety lights and mounted safety lights. These safety features are usually missing from railroad crossings, and this could pose a risk for anyone in the vicinity.

Railroad workers are particularly at risk of serious injury or death due to the poor track condition. This is because they work with moving machines that are sometimes difficult to control, and if the track condition is not safe, it can lead to devastating accidents.

Negligence by the Railroad Company

While train travel is more secure than driving, the accidents that may occur could cause severe injuries to victims. To ensure that they receive maximum compensation the victims must seek legal advice to help them understand their rights. A train accident attorney can help victims comprehend complex legal concepts like comparative negligence and contributory fault.

To establish negligence, you must prove that the party responsible acted in violation of their duty of responsibility and that the breach caused your injury and accident. This involves gathering and analyzing the evidence, such as eyewitness testimony, official reports, medical documents and so on. It is essential to preserve any physical evidence, like trains, tracks or other related objects.

A lawyer who is involved in a train accident will review and gather the evidence to determine who is the party responsible. This could include the train operator, the railway company, manufacturers of defective equipment, or even government entities responsible for track maintenance. If multiple parties are held accountable, they could be jointly and severally responsible for your injuries.

One type of evidence that can prove negligence is neglecting or failing to perform regular maintenance. Evidence of poor maintenance practices or ineffective handling of issues that are well-known can be used as a strong argument to demonstrate a railroad company's lack of adherence to their duty of care.

The FELA also imposes a requirement on rail companies to ensure an environment that is safe for each employee. This includes an uninjured roadbed, track cars, locomotives tools, machinery and working conditions. Evidence of this duty can be used to establish a railroad company's liability for an employee's injury.

Final Train accident lawyers can utilize evidence of cumulative trauma to prove the railroad's liability for injuries sustained by employees. This legal principle allows railroad workers suffering from ailments such as lung disease and hearing loss over time to receive damages.

In a typical train derailment the wheels lose contact with tracks and are pushed off of their designated path. This could be due to an operational error, for instance, moving at too fast of a rate over a curved stretch of track, or due to mechanical issues in the train's axles, wheels or tracks. In the event of a derailment the train's cargo may also be released into the environment which can create additional dangers to safety.

Train cargo can be dangerous and cause health issues if released into the air or come into contact with waterways. The February 3 derailment at East Palestine, Ohio caused chemical releases into the local waterways, which prompted residents in the area to leave.

Aside from being dangerous, a derailed train can be very costly to clean up. Even minor derailments can result in costly secondary damage to the track and other infrastructure, such as roads bridges, buildings, and bridges. Additionally the cargo of the train could spill onto the ground and pollute local communities and natural resources.
